Digital Platforms in MENAT:
E‑Governance Shaping the Future of Product Registration
Digital transformation is rapidly redefining how companies register, launch, and manage products across the MENAT region.
What once required in‑person visits, manual signatures, and fragmented procedures is now shifting toward modern e‑governance systems built for clarity, efficiency, and regulatory accuracy.
MENAT authorities are accelerating their adoption of digital platforms to support smoother product registration, faster verification cycles, and better communication with businesses.
For companies entering markets such as the UAE, Saudi Arabia, and Egypt, understanding these platforms is no longer optional—it's essential for reliable, compliant market access.
How Digital Transformation Supports MENAT Product Registration
Digital platforms across the region are designed to create a cleaner and more predictable regulatory environment. The shift to e‑governance enables:
Centralized documentation and submission
Clearer visibility of application status
Fewer manual errors during form completion
Consistent communication with regulatory authorities
Stronger control over regulatory timelines
Businesses that invest in understanding these systems benefit from fewer delays, improved accuracy, and stronger compliance alignment.
UAE: Leading MENAT’s Digital Adoption in Product Registration
The UAE is widely recognized for its forward-thinking regulatory infrastructure. Digital portals across Dubai and other Emirates simplify how companies prepare and submit product files.
Dubai Municipality’s Online Product Registration System
Dubai Municipality has introduced a fully online registration procedure for product categories including cosmetics, supplements, detergents, and more. Companies can now:
Submit product documentation digitally instead of visiting service centers
Track application progress in real time through online dashboards
Manage clarifications and responses entirely within the portal
Use bilingual Arabic–English interfaces for greater accuracy
The platform standardizes application formats and reduces the risk of missing forms or misinterpreting requirements.
While occasional system slowdowns or unfamiliar forms can occur, businesses prepared with proper document formatting and labeling specifications experience smoother approvals.
Why UAE’s Digital Infrastructure Matters
The UAE’s digitized regulatory systems help companies maintain transparency and ensure their dossiers remain aligned with updated requirements.
Organizations that proactively organize their documentation—labels, formulas, certificates, and translations—benefit from faster verification and fewer revision cycles.

Saudi Arabia: SFDA’s Unified Digital Framework
Saudi Arabia continues to modernize its regulatory environment through the Saudi Food and Drug Authority (SFDA) digital platform.
This comprehensive system serves as a hub for registering food, cosmetics, medical devices, pharmaceuticals, and related categories.
The SFDA Digital Portal
The SFDA portal consolidates complex regulatory workflows into a structured digital pathway. Companies can:
Register products under various categories within one account
Receive notifications and updates throughout each application stage
Review compliance requirements and upload documentation electronically
Track submissions and respond to clarifications promptly
Its mobile-responsive design helps businesses stay aligned with regulatory expectations, ensuring no deadlines or critical updates are missed.
Ensuring Smooth Progress Through SFDA
Accuracy is central to SFDA success. Mistakes in classification, ingredient entries, certificate formats, or Arabic terminology can trigger delays.
A clear understanding of SFDA’s terminology and structured workflows helps companies avoid unnecessary revisions.

Egypt: NTRA’s E‑Platform and the Rise of Digital Regulatory Systems
Egypt is significantly enhancing its regulatory operations through digital solutions led by the National Telecom Regulatory Authority (NTRA) and additional government bodies.
Egypt’s Digital Approval Framework
Egypt’s move toward digital systems aims to streamline regulatory oversight and increase operational transparency. Modernized features include:
Secure digital storage for regulatory documentation
Online payment gateways for application fees
Automated document verification to reduce manual checks
These improvements help companies maintain accurate submission records while accelerating review timelines.
Meeting Egypt’s Changing Digital Requirements
Egypt's regulatory frameworks continue to evolve, with periodic updates to documentation formats, category rules, and submission processes. Businesses that consistently monitor portal announcements and prepare compliant Arabic and English documentation tend to avoid avoidable delays.

Why Digital Platforms Improve Compliance in MENAT
Adopting digital systems has provided measurable benefits to companies operating in the region. These include:
Transparency: Real-time application tracking replaces uncertainty with clear visibility.
Accuracy: Standardized digital forms reduce inconsistencies across applications.
Security: Online portals use advanced encryption to protect business-sensitive information.
Centralized communication: All regulatory communication is stored in one place, preventing information gaps.
Reduced turnaround time: Digital submissions minimize administrative delays and speed up processing.
Preparing Your Organization for MENAT’s Digital Regulatory Systems
To operate effectively within MENAT’s evolving regulatory landscape, businesses should:
Maintain organized digital documentation for labels, formulas, certificates, and translations
Confirm correct product classification before submitting any file
Ensure both Arabic and English labels meet local regulatory expectations
Verify certificates from globally recognized authorities
Review platform-specific requirements before uploading documents
Understanding the detailed workflows of each digital system helps companies prevent delays and achieve faster, more predictable approvals.
